Frequently Asked Questions:

  1. How hot are White Habanero Peppers? White Habanero peppers rank very high on the Scoville scale, often exceeding 300,000 Scoville Heat Units (SHU).
  2. What is the best way to care for my White Habanero Pepper Plants? Provide well-drained soil, plenty of sunlight (at least 6-8 hours per day), and regular watering. Avoid overwatering.
  3. When can I expect to harvest my peppers? Expect to harvest your peppers approximately 80 days after planting the seedlings.
  4. Can I grow these pepper plants indoors? Yes, White Habanero Pepper Plants can be grown indoors with sufficient light, either natural or artificial.
  5. What size pot is recommended for these plants? A pot that is at least 6-8 inches in diameter is recommended to ensure proper root development.
